In Mexico, anything with any conceivable future use is saved and used again. It is really pretty amazing. I will have to take my camera out and collect some pictures.
Just for one example, produce around here comes in these wooden crates called rejas. If you are lucky, you can get your hands on the plastic crates like my Mom uses at her house. I haven't been that lucky, yet.

And when they get really shabby, as in, a lot of cracked boards or rotted, people that cook outside on brazeros, basically a camping-style cooking fire elevated up on a table, will come buy them for cooking wood.
